AI
HubDirectory

Menu

AI Hub © 2026

DeepBrain AI logo

DeepBrain AI

Visit Website

DeepBrain AI is an AI-powered video generation platform that creates realistic AI avatar videos from text. It uses advanced speech synthesis and deep learning to produce natural-looking presenters. The platform is commonly used for news broadcasting, education, customer support, and corporate communication content.

Rating★ 4.5
PricingPaid
Reviews10K+
CategoryVideo

Face

Tool Interface Preview

Introduction

DeepBrain AI is an AI-powered video platform that converts text scripts into professional videos featuring realistic AI presenters and voice-overs. It is widely used for corporate training, news, marketing, and educational purposes.

About

DeepBrain AI enables organizations to create videos without filming real presenters. The platform uses AI avatars that deliver the script naturally, supporting multiple languages and custom branding options for professional-quality video production.

Work

Users input a script, select an AI presenter avatar, choose a voice style and language, and the AI generates a video where the avatar presents the content naturally. Branding and visual customization options can also be applied.

Key Features

Check out my core capabilities below:

#AI Presenter Videos
#Voice Cloning
#Script-to-Video Conversion
#Multilingual Support
#Custom Branding Options

Limitations

While DeepBrain AI is effective for professional AI video creation, it offers limited flexibility for avatar customization and advanced cinematic editing. The quality of output depends heavily on script clarity and avatar choice.

Where Used

DeepBrain AI is widely used in corporate training, e-learning modules, marketing videos, news presentations, and other professional video content where AI presenters can replace real actors.

Pros and Cons

Every tool has its strengths and weaknesses:

Strengths

  • Realistic AI presenters for professional videos
  • Supports voice cloning and multiple languages
  • Fast script-to-video workflow
  • Custom branding options available
  • Ideal for corporate and educational content

Weakness

  • Limited flexibility in avatar customization
  • Paid subscription required
  • Not suitable for cinematic or highly creative videos
  • Dependent on script clarity for best results

Future

DeepBrain AI aims to improve avatar customization, enhance voice realism, support more languages, and expand features for greater creative control and interactivity in AI video production.

Challenges

Challenges include ensuring natural avatar expressions, improving voice synthesis quality, providing more flexibility in avatar appearance, and balancing automation with creative control for professional users.

Conclusion

DeepBrain AI is a professional AI video platform for creating presenter-led videos efficiently. It is ideal for corporate, educational, and marketing content, though advanced cinematic or highly creative videos may require additional editing tools.

Launch DeepBrain AI

Visit Website